| dc.description.abstract (摘要) | Amid the transformative repercussions of the COVID-19 pandemic, this study underscores the critical need for libraries to evolve beyond simple digitization towards achieving robust digital resilience, positioning it as foundational for sustainable development. By delving into the relatively unexplored domain of digital resilience in the library sector, this investigation conducts a comprehensive literature review to establish its core principles. An in-depth case study of Taiwan's National Central Library demonstrates the practical application of digital resilience in fostering sustainable development, highlighting the library’s strategic efforts to overcome digital transformation challenges. This research elucidates the integration of digital resilience strategies within library management, emphasizing how such strategies can drive sustainable advancement for organizations and society. The findings enrich the discourse on leveraging digital transformation to achieve long-term sustainability, showcasing the National Central Library as a model for libraries worldwide. | - |
